Zelenskyy: Ukrainian Forces Derailed Russia's Planned March Offensive.
Russia’s Spring Offensive Thwarted by Ukraine’s Military
According to Novyny.live: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y announced that the country’s armed forces successfully disrupted a Russian offensive that had been scheduled for March. According to him, while Moscow made numerous attempts to push forward, its troops ultimately failed to achieve their objectives.
Speaking on March 20, Zelenskyy highlighted the daily bravery of Ukraine’s defense forces.
“Our soldiers derailed the offensive the Russians had planned. It was supposed to take place at the start of spring, specifically in March. Every day, our warriors display extraordinary heroism,” the president stated.
